If you intend to adopt a child whether he or she may be coming from in or out of the country, it is best that you get the services of adoption attorneys. Without their participation you will only have a hard time processing the papers and finalizing the adoption. Aside from that it would be much easier to employ the services of a lawyer who is familiar with the whole process so that there will be less mistakes incurred.
You may find that adoption agencies and even non profit adoption organizations usually have their own adoption attorneys working with them and they can help you adopt a child in an easier and faster way.
Aside from that you should also consider the fact that adoption laws and legal requirements vary from one country to another. These attorneys are familiar with the laws and requirements nationally and internationally as well. There are things that would definitely need the help of someone that has legal training throughout the adoption process and going through it all by yourself can be very stressful in your part.
The process of adoption can also be very emotional. The presence of adoption attorneys backing you up will help give you a sense of calm and security throughout the whole process.
Given the many benefits that they can give you, it is important that you get to work with the best adoption attorneys to guide you as you enter a new chapter in your life. Here are some pointers that you can use when it comes to choosing the best adoption attorney that you can work with:
• Make sure that you get referrals from other professionals, friends and family members. You can also approach people you knew have adopted before and ask if there is someone that they can recommend to help you out.
• Make a list of the best adoption attorneys or agencies in your area that meets your needs and your budget. Make sure that you ask about adoptive parent requirements and up-front fees.
• Verify their license by calling your state adoption agency licensing specialists. Make sure that the license is still active and that there have been no complaints filed against them.
• You should also do a background check with the Better Business Bureau or your state Attorney General’s office. Do not work with agencies or adoption attorneys that you have not investigated yourself.
In the end, it is recommended that you keep at least two things in mind when you choose your adoption attorney. First is that you are the client and it is important that the attorney of your choice makes your comfort and security a priority. And second, it is always best to trust your instincts. If you feel that something does not feel right then it is best that you look for someone else.
